新闻资讯
看你所看,想你所想

程式设计与算法语言:C++程式设计基础

程式设计与算法语言:C++程式设计基础(程式设计与算法语言)

程式设计与算法语言:C++程式设计基础

程式设计与算法语言一般指本词条

《程式设计与算法语言C++程式设计基础》是2011年9月清华大学出版社出版的图书,作者是孔丽英、夏艳、徐勇。

基本介绍

  • 书名:程式设计与算法语言:C++程式设计基础
  • 作者:孔丽英、夏艳、徐勇
  • ISBN:9787302262886
  • 定价:29.50元
  • 出版社:清华大学出版社
  • 出版时间:2011年9月1日

内容简介

《程式设计与算法语言:C++程式设计基础》以程式设计为主线,通过案例教学引入数学模型的建立和算法的设计,详细分析程式,以培养读者分析程式和设计程式的能力。全书共分9章。第1章介绍计算机求解问题的步骤和算法设计、电脑程式和C/C++语言。第2~7章是面向过程程式设计基础,介绍数据类型和表达式、程式结构、控制结构程式设计、函式、构造数据类型和指针。第8章是面向对象程式设计基础,介绍类和对象、构造函式、析构函式、对象指针、静态成员、友元、继承和多态性。第9章介绍档案、流类库、通过档案指针(或流)操作档案和输入输出格式控制。
《程式设计与算法语言:C++程式设计基础》可作为高校非计算机专业的本科教材和自学教材以及高职各专业的教材,也可供广大软体工作者参考。

图书目录

目录
第1章程式设计概述
1.1计算机求解问题的步骤和算法
1.1.1计算机求解问题的步骤
1.1.2算法设计
1.2电脑程式
1.2.1程式设计语言
1.2.2编译与解释
1.2.3程式设计方法
1.3C/C++语言简介
1.3.1C语言简介
1.3.2C++语言简介
习题1
第2章数据类型和表达式
2.1基本数据类型
2.1.1整数类型
2.1.2实数类型
2.1.3字元类型
2.1.4布尔类型
2.1.5空类型
2.2C++的字元集
2.2.1字元集
2.2.2标识符
2.3常量与符号常量
2.3.1值常量
2.3.2符号常量
2.4变数与常变数
2.4.1变数
2.4.2常变数
2.5表达式
2.5.1运算符
2.5.2表达式运算规则
2.6类型的转换
习题2
第3章程式结构
3.1简单语句
3.1.1表达式语句
3.1.2空语句
3.1.3複合语句
3.2预处理命令
3.2.1“档案包含”命令
3.2.2宏定义
3.3数据的输入输出
3.3.1标準输入输出函式
3.3.2格式化输入输出函式
3.3.3输入输出流对象
3.4C++程式
3.4.1程式运行的步骤
3.4.2C++程式结构
习题3
第4章控制结构程式设计
4.1顺序结构程式设计
4.2选择结构程式设计
4.2.1if语句
4.2.2switch语句
4.3循环结构程式设计
4.3.1while语句
4.3.2do-while语句
4.3.3for语句
4.3.4循环语句小结
4.4多重循环程式设计
4.5常用转移语句
4.5.1break语句
4.5.2continue语句
习题4
第5章函式
5.1引言
5.2函式的定义与调用
5.2.1函式的定义
5.2.2函式调用方式
5.3参数传递方式
5.3.1值传递
5.3.2地址传递
5.4变数的作用域
5.4.1局部变数
5.4.2全局变数
5.5变数的存储类别
5.5.1自动变数
5.5.2暂存器变数
5.5.3静态局部变数
5.5.4外部变数的声明
5.6嵌套与递归
5.6.1嵌套
5.6.2递归
5.7有默认参数的函式
5.8内联函式和函式重载
5.8.1内联函式
5.8.2函式重载
习题5
第6章构造数据类型
6.1数组
6.1.1一维数组
6.1.2二维数组
6.1.3字元数组
6.1.4数组与函式
6.1.5字元串处理函式
6.2结构体类型
6.2.1结构体类型的定义
6.2.2结构体变数的定义
6.2.3结构体变数的使用
6.2.4结构体变数的初始化
6.2.5结构体数组
6.2.6结构体类型的套用
6.2.7结构体与函式
6.3联合体类型
6.3.1联合体类型的定义
6.3.2联合体变数的定义
6.3.3联合体类型数据的使用
6.3.4联合体类型数据的初始化
6.3.5联合体类型数据的套用
习题6
第7章指针
7.1指针的基本知识
7.1.1地址和指针
7.1.2指针的基本运算
7.2指针与数组
7.2.1指针与一维数组
7.2.2指针与二维数组
7.2.3指针数组
7.2.4指针与字元串
7.3指针与函式
7.4指针与结构体
7.5指向指针的指针与常指针
习题7
第8章面向对象程式设计基础
8.1基本概念
8.2类和对象
8.2.1类的定义
8.2.2对象与对象数组
8.3构造函式和析构函式
8.3.1构造函式
8.3.2析构函式
8.3.3拷贝构造函式
8.4对象指针
8.4.1指向对象的指针
8.4.2this指针
8.5静态成员
8.5.1静态数据成员
8.5.2静态成员函式
8.6友元
8.6.1友元函式
8.6.2友元类
8.7继承
8.7.1基本概念
8.7.2继承方式
8.7.3继承的构造函式和析构函式
8.8多态性
8.8.1基本概念
8.8.2虚函式
8.8.3抽象类
习题8
第9章档案和流
9.1基本概念
9.1.1档案
9.1.2档案指针
9.2流类库
9.2.1基本结构
9.2.2预定义流
9.2.3档案流类
9.3通过档案指针操作档案
9.3.1档案打开与关闭
9.3.2文本档案操作
9.3.3二进制档案操作
9.3.4档案的随机读写
9.4通过档案流操作档案
9.4.1档案打开与关闭
9.4.2文本档案操作
9.4.3二进制档案操作
9.4.4档案的随机读写
9.5输入输出格式控制
9.5.1使用ios成员函式控制格式
9.5.2格式控制符
习题9
实验指导
附录A常用ASCII码
附录B常用的数学函式
附录C常用关键字
参考文献

转载请注明出处海之美文 » 程式设计与算法语言:C++程式设计基础

相关推荐

    声明:此文信息来源于网络,登载此文只为提供信息参考,并不用于任何商业目的。如有侵权,请及时联系我们:ailianmeng11@163.com